Our Ascot Horse Racing Tips for Wednesday’s meeting.
Best Bet
Truly Inspired (Ascot Race 6 No. 3)
This six-year-old Dundeel gelding has only had 6 starts, for one win and one place. He resumed from a spell of over a year for 2.4 lengths 4th over 1600m at Ascot on 15 October, then came from back in the field for 1.7 lengths 4th over 1800m at Ascot on 29 October. William Pike rides him for only the 2nd time after winning a Northam maiden on him back in June 2021. Rates highly.
$1.70

Best Each Way
Never Sober (Ascot Race 5 No. 1)
This four-year-old gelding trained by Ashley Maley has three wins and four places from 16 starts. He reached the front in the final stride for a very narrow win over 1800m at Ascot on 8 October, then didn’t finish it off when 2.2 lengths 4th over 1400m at Ascot on 22 October. Gets a 3kg claim here and looks a solid each-way chance.
$5.70
Best Lay
Nunes (Ascot Race 7 No. 9)
This three-year-old Sizzling filly is the early favourite in this Class One Handicap race over 1200m. She was well-supported in the betting when she won a 1200m Maiden at Ascot by 1.2 lengths on 12 October, then she went straight to a Listed race where she finished 5.2 lengths 6th in the Burgess Queen Stakes over 1400m on 1 November. Has a 3kg claim here but still looks tested.
